LT3091ER#TRPBF operates as a linear voltage regulator. It uses a feedback mechanism to maintain a constant output voltage, regardless of changes in the input voltage or load conditions. The device compares the output voltage with a reference voltage and adjusts the internal circuitry to achieve the desired output.
